I have just gotten my new ipad!!! I downloaded latest version of itunes but my ipad does not show in devices when I try to sync music. Any suggestions??
Does a little box come up seeing the iPad as a camera? That doesn't impact iTunes as much as it confirms that your computer sees the device. If your computer doesn't see it then iTunes doesn't know it's there.
If you're plugged into a hub or extender, try plugging it directly into the box or main part of your computer.
If you're using an extension, stop and just use the included sync cable.
Try using a different USB port.
After you installed iTunes, did you restart your computer?
Usually what's needed is the 'apple device driver' which installs automatically, you just need to sometimes trigger the install, using different ports helps with that.
If the simple trouble shooting doesn't help then you can search on the Apple Device Driver and there's more detailed trouble shooting on the site. -

I have my PC on, then plug in my iPad (which is on) and open iTunes. The iPad does not show up in the sidebar. How do you get it to show up so that I can select the iPad and then configure the sync settings in each of the settings panes....hoping that these actually show up.
In the manual it says "log in to your computer user account before connecting iPad". I am the only user of this PC...does this mean some other user account. I am confused. I need "baby steps" to tell me how to do all this....very senior and just learning about this wonderful machine. I will very much appreciate your help.If you are the only user on your computer you probably don't have multiple user accounts set up and can disregard that. If you are using iTunes 11 go to View>Show Sidebar. Now see if your iPad appears under Devices on the left side when you connect it. If it does, click on the name of your iPad on the left side and your iTunes sync settings options will appear in folders with tabbed headings to the right.
If it doesn't appear on the left side, follow the troubleshooting steps shown in this article: http://support.apple.com/kb/TS1538. -
